NXOpen .NET Reference  12.0.0
NXOpen.ScRuleFactory Member List

This is the complete list of members for NXOpen.ScRuleFactory, including all inherited members.

CreateRuleApparentChaining(NXOpen.ICurve seedCurve, NXOpen.View view, NXOpen.ApparentChainingRuleType chainingMethod, NXOpen.ApparentChainingRuleSelection selectionMask, double chainingTolerance, double angleTolerance)NXOpen.ScRuleFactory
CreateRuleBaseCurveDumb(NXOpen.IBaseCurve[] curves)NXOpen.ScRuleFactory
CreateRuleBodyDumb(NXOpen.Body[] bodies)NXOpen.ScRuleFactory
CreateRuleBodyDumb(NXOpen.Body[] bodies, bool includeSheetBodies)NXOpen.ScRuleFactory
CreateRuleBodyFeature(NXOpen.Features.Feature[] features)NXOpen.ScRuleFactory
CreateRuleBodyFeature(NXOpen.Features.Feature[] features, bool includeSheetBodies)NXOpen.ScRuleFactory
CreateRuleBodyFeature(NXOpen.Features.Feature[] features, NXOpen.DisplayableObject partOccurrence)NXOpen.ScRuleFactory
CreateRuleBodyFeature(NXOpen.Features.Feature[] features, bool includeSheetBodies, NXOpen.DisplayableObject partOccurrence)NXOpen.ScRuleFactory
CreateRuleBodyGroup(NXOpen.Group[] groups)NXOpen.ScRuleFactory
CreateRuleBodyGroup(NXOpen.Group[] groups, bool includeSheetBodies)NXOpen.ScRuleFactory
CreateRuleCurveChain(NXOpen.ICurve seedCurve, NXOpen.ICurve endCurve, bool isFromSeedStart, double gapTolerance)NXOpen.ScRuleFactory
CreateRuleCurveDumb(NXOpen.Curve[] curves)NXOpen.ScRuleFactory
CreateRuleCurveDumbFromPoints(NXOpen.Point[] points)NXOpen.ScRuleFactory
CreateRuleCurveFeature(NXOpen.Features.Feature[] features)NXOpen.ScRuleFactory
CreateRuleCurveFeature(NXOpen.Features.Feature[] features, NXOpen.DisplayableObject partOccurrence)NXOpen.ScRuleFactory
CreateRuleCurveFeatureChain(NXOpen.Features.Feature[] features, NXOpen.Curve seedCurve, NXOpen.Curve endCurve, bool isFromSeedStart, double gapTolerance)NXOpen.ScRuleFactory
CreateRuleCurveFeatureTangent(NXOpen.Features.Feature[] features, NXOpen.Curve seedCurve, NXOpen.Curve endCurve, bool isFromSeedStart, double angleTolerance, double gapTolerance)NXOpen.ScRuleFactory
CreateRuleCurveGroup(NXOpen.Group[] groups)NXOpen.ScRuleFactory
CreateRuleCurveTangent(NXOpen.ICurve seedCurve, NXOpen.ICurve endCurve, bool isFromSeedStart, double angleTolerance, double gapTolerance)NXOpen.ScRuleFactory
CreateRuleEdgeBody(NXOpen.Body body)NXOpen.ScRuleFactory
CreateRuleEdgeBoundary(NXOpen.Face[] facesOfFeatures)NXOpen.ScRuleFactory
CreateRuleEdgeChain(NXOpen.Edge startEdge, NXOpen.Edge endEdge, bool isFromStart)NXOpen.ScRuleFactory
CreateRuleEdgeChain(NXOpen.Edge startEdge, NXOpen.Edge endEdge, bool isFromStart, NXOpen.Face commonFace, bool allowLaminarEdge)NXOpen.ScRuleFactory
CreateRuleEdgeDumb(NXOpen.Edge[] edges)NXOpen.ScRuleFactory
CreateRuleEdgeFace(NXOpen.Face[] faces)NXOpen.ScRuleFactory
CreateRuleEdgeFeature(NXOpen.Features.Feature[] features)NXOpen.ScRuleFactory
CreateRuleEdgeFeature(NXOpen.Features.Feature[] features, NXOpen.DisplayableObject partOccurrence)NXOpen.ScRuleFactory
CreateRuleEdgeIntersect(NXOpen.Face[] facesOfFeatures1, NXOpen.Face[] facesOfFeatures2)NXOpen.ScRuleFactory
CreateRuleEdgeMultipleSeedTangent(NXOpen.Edge[] seedEdges, double angleTolerance, bool hasSameConvexity)NXOpen.ScRuleFactory
CreateRuleEdgeSheetBoundary(NXOpen.Body sheet)NXOpen.ScRuleFactory
CreateRuleEdgeTangent(NXOpen.Edge startEdge, NXOpen.Edge endEdge, bool isFromStart, double angleTolerance, bool hasSameConvexity)NXOpen.ScRuleFactory
CreateRuleEdgeTangent(NXOpen.Edge startEdge, NXOpen.Edge endEdge, bool isFromStart, double angleTolerance, bool hasSameConvexity, bool allowLaminarEdge)NXOpen.ScRuleFactory
CreateRuleEdgeVertex(NXOpen.Edge startEdge, bool isFromStart)NXOpen.ScRuleFactory
CreateRuleEdgeVertexTangent(NXOpen.Edge startEdge, bool isFromStart, double angleTolerance, bool hasSameConvexity)NXOpen.ScRuleFactory
CreateRuleFaceAdjacent(NXOpen.Face seedFace)NXOpen.ScRuleFactory
CreateRuleFaceAllBlend(NXOpen.Body body)NXOpen.ScRuleFactory
CreateRuleFaceAllBlend(NXOpen.Body body, NXOpen.Features.Feature feature)NXOpen.ScRuleFactory
CreateRuleFaceAndAdjacentFaces(NXOpen.Face seedFace)NXOpen.ScRuleFactory
CreateRuleFaceBody(NXOpen.Body body)NXOpen.ScRuleFactory
CreateRuleFaceBossPocket(NXOpen.Face seed)NXOpen.ScRuleFactory
CreateRuleFaceBossPocket(NXOpen.Face seed, bool includeBoundaryBlends)NXOpen.ScRuleFactory
CreateRuleFaceConnectedBlend(NXOpen.Face seedFace)NXOpen.ScRuleFactory
CreateRuleFaceConnectedBlend(NXOpen.Face seedFace, bool includeBlendLike, NXOpen.Features.Feature feature)NXOpen.ScRuleFactory
CreateRuleFaceConnectedBlend(NXOpen.Face seedFace, bool includeBlendLike, bool includeUnlabeledBlend, NXOpen.Features.Feature feature)NXOpen.ScRuleFactory
CreateRuleFaceDatum(NXOpen.DatumPlane[] faces)NXOpen.ScRuleFactory
CreateRuleFaceDumb(NXOpen.Face[] faces)NXOpen.ScRuleFactory
CreateRuleFaceFeature(NXOpen.Features.Feature[] features)NXOpen.ScRuleFactory
CreateRuleFaceFeature(NXOpen.Features.Feature[] features, NXOpen.DisplayableObject partOccurrence)NXOpen.ScRuleFactory
CreateRuleFaceMergedRib(NXOpen.Face seed, NXOpen.Edge edge)NXOpen.ScRuleFactory
CreateRuleFaceMergedRib(NXOpen.Face seed, NXOpen.Edge edge, bool includeBoundaryBlends)NXOpen.ScRuleFactory
CreateRuleFaceMergedRib(NXOpen.Face seed, bool includeBoundaryBlends, NXOpen.Point3d seedPoint)NXOpen.ScRuleFactory
CreateRuleFaceRegion(NXOpen.Face seedFace, NXOpen.Face[] boundaryFaces)NXOpen.ScRuleFactory
CreateRuleFaceRegionBoundary(NXOpen.Face seedObj, NXOpen.ICurve[] curves, NXOpen.Point3d seedPoint, double distanceTolerance)NXOpen.ScRuleFactory
CreateRuleFaceRegionWithSmartBoundaries(NXOpen.Face seedFace, NXOpen.SelectionIntentRule[] boundaryFaceRules)NXOpen.ScRuleFactory
CreateRuleFaceRib(NXOpen.Face seed)NXOpen.ScRuleFactory
CreateRuleFaceRib(NXOpen.Face seed, bool includeBoundaryBlends, bool traverseInteriorLoops)NXOpen.ScRuleFactory
CreateRuleFaceSlot(NXOpen.Face seed)NXOpen.ScRuleFactory
CreateRuleFaceSlot(NXOpen.Face seed, bool includeBoundaryBlends, bool traverseInteriorLoops)NXOpen.ScRuleFactory
CreateRuleFaceTangent(NXOpen.Face seedFace, NXOpen.Face[] boundaryFaces)NXOpen.ScRuleFactory
CreateRuleFaceTangent(NXOpen.Face seedFace, NXOpen.Face[] boundaryFaces, double angleTolerance)NXOpen.ScRuleFactory
CreateRuleFaceTangentWithSmartBoundaries(NXOpen.Face seedFace, NXOpen.SelectionIntentRule[] boundaryFaceRules)NXOpen.ScRuleFactory
CreateRuleFeatureIntersectionEdges(NXOpen.NXObject[] features)NXOpen.ScRuleFactory
CreateRuleFeatureIntersectionEdges(NXOpen.NXObject[] features, NXOpen.DisplayableObject partOccurrence)NXOpen.ScRuleFactory
CreateRuleFeaturePoints(NXOpen.Features.Feature[] features, NXOpen.DisplayableObject partOccurrence)NXOpen.ScRuleFactory
CreateRuleFeaturePoints(NXOpen.Features.Feature[] features)NXOpen.ScRuleFactory
CreateRuleFollowFillet(NXOpen.Features.Feature[] features, NXOpen.Body[] bodies, NXOpen.ICurve[] basicCurves, NXOpen.ICurve seedWireframe, NXOpen.ICurve endWireframe, bool isFromSeedStart, NXOpen.Point3d seedPoint, double gapTolerance, double angleTolerance, NXOpen.FollowFilletRuleType method)NXOpen.ScRuleFactory
CreateRuleFollowFillet(NXOpen.Features.Feature[] features, NXOpen.Body[] bodies, NXOpen.ICurve[] basicCurves, NXOpen.ICurve seedWireframe, NXOpen.Point3d seedPoint, double gapTolerance, double angleTolerance, NXOpen.FollowFilletRuleType method)NXOpen.ScRuleFactory
CreateRuleOuterEdgesOfFaces(NXOpen.NXObject[] facesOfFeatures)NXOpen.ScRuleFactory
CreateRuleRegionBoundary(NXOpen.DisplayableObject seedObj, NXOpen.ICurve[] curves, NXOpen.Point3d seedPoint, double distanceTolerance)NXOpen.ScRuleFactory
CreateRuleRibTopFaceEdges(NXOpen.NXObject[] facesOfFeatures)NXOpen.ScRuleFactory
TagNXOpen.ScRuleFactory
Copyright 2017 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.